Huntress is a managed cybersecurity platform that protects small and mid-market businesses from cybercriminals. Their services include managed endpoint protection, detection and response, Microsoft 365 identity protection, and security awareness traini...

Description

  • Design, develop, and maintain end-to-end software solutions primarily in Ruby on Rails.
  • Implement efficient data pipelines to extract relevant information from large volumes of noisy data.
  • Collaborate with security researchers to understand attack methods and develop defenses.
  • Provide architectural and design direction as a technical thought leader for the team.
  • Improve solution quality through code reviews, manual testing, and automated testing.
  • Set engineering standards and create processes that improve team efficiency.
  • Lead and mentor junior engineers on larger projects, including breaking down ambiguous work into actionable tasks.
  • Validate designs and serve as a point of contact for stakeholders.
  • Design systems and architecture to process petabytes of data efficiently.
  • Work across the stack, including building UI, data models, event ingestion, and automated detectors.

Requirements

  • 10+ years of experience developing complex software products.
  • 5+ years of programming experience with Ruby on Rails.
  • Experience using AI coding tools such as Claude Code.
  • Experience with relational databases such as Postgres.
  • Experience working in the cybersecurity industry is preferred.
  • Experience working with external APIs, particularly REST, OData, and authZ/authN flows, is preferred.
  • Familiarity with identity and resource security providers such as Microsoft 365, Okta, or Google Workspace is preferred.
  • Experience with other data storage technologies such as ClickHouse, Redis, Elasticsearch, or MongoDB is preferred.

Benefits

  • 100% remote work environment.
  • Generous paid time off, including vacation, sick time, and paid holidays.
  • 12 weeks of paid parental leave.
  • Comprehensive medical, dental, and vision insurance.
  • 401(k) with a 5% company contribution regardless of employee contribution.
  • Life and disability insurance plans.
  • Stock options for all full-time employees.
  • One-time $500 home office reimbursement.
  • Annual education and professional development allowance.
  • $75 per month digital reimbursement.
  • Access to the BetterUp platform for coaching and growth.
  • Compensation range of $200,000 to $220,000 base plus bonus and equity.
